There are several sorts of acne scarring: , hypertrophic scarring, ice pick scarring, atrophic scarring.

Treatment of acne scars ranges from basic skin creams to laser treatment, skin graft, and painful dermabrasion.

The single approach to fully stop acne scars is by correctly treating acne lesions straightaway.

Luckily, with today's advancements, removal of acne scars is enabling individuals to recover without any lasting effects.

Acne scar treatment is a hard procedure. Depending on the sort of scar , there are various scar removal techniques with different degrees of effectiveness.

Here's a list below of techniques for different types of acne scarring:

  • Atrophic scar removal procedures include: , Laser Resurfacing, Dermabrasian, Collagen injections & fat implants.
  • Hypertrophic scars removal techniques include: , Intralesional steroid injections, Potent topical steroids, Silicone Injection, Cryotherapy Surgical revision.
  • Acne Scar procedures for ice pick scars include: , Punch grafting, Laser Resurfacing, Subcision, Dermabrasian.
